The visual accumulation tube is used to assess particle sizes of sediments. It consists of a vertical transparent settling tube through which sediment samples are passed. Particles settle individually based on terminal velocity related to diameter, and accumulated sediment volume in the tube's narrow end relates to solid weight. It is best for uniform, spherical particles. The analysis involves introducing a small sample and recording accumulated sediment height over time.

The document specifies the requirements for a microprocessor-controlled TOC analyzer. It must be able to directly measure total carbon, total organic carbon, and purgeable organic carbon in water samples. It uses high temperature catalytic combustion up to 900属C and non-dispersive infrared detection. It must have a measuring range of 1-500 mg/L carbon, precision within 3%, and detection limit of at least 500 ppb carbon. The analyzer and auto-sampler require 240V 50Hz power and it uses nitrogen or high purity air as carrier gases. It includes an auto-sampler, syringes, printer, manuals, spare parts, and application software in English.

The document describes the specifications for a total Kjeldahl nitrogen analyzer system. The system consists of a digestion unit, scrubber unit, and distillation unit. The digestion unit has electrically heated blocks capable of temperatures from 45-450属C and can accommodate at least six 200ml digestion tubes. The scrubber unit is oil-free and collects condensate and acid fumes. The distillation unit has a borosilicate glass steam generator and pump for alkali dispensing. The system requires quality certificates and accessories including spare parts for two years of use.
